🏛️ Federal Title I context

Title I Schoolwide eligible

≥40% FRPL — qualifies for Title I Schoolwide program

65.9%
FRPL rate — % of students who qualify for the federal Free or Reduced-Price Lunch program. This is the underlying federal income-eligibility signal Title I designations are computed from (ESEA Sec. 1113).
0% (no FRPL) 35% TA · 40% Schoolwide 100% (universal FRPL)

40-74% of students qualify for free/reduced lunch. The district can use Title I funds across the whole school under federal Schoolwide Program rules.

Source: NCES Common Core of Data, free/reduced-price lunch eligibility. The actual Title I designation is a district decision and may differ from eligibility — but the federal eligibility math is what we show here. We don't claim to assert whether the district formally chose to enroll this school in Title I.

💰 Pay for college in Florida

Florida's public scholarships

Florida's Bright Futures pays 75–100% of in-state tuition by tier, based on GPA, test scores, and community-service hours. We built a calculator that checks the exact thresholds for you.

Merit Bright Futures (FAS & FMS)
75%–100% of in-state public-college tuition (by tier)
GPA: 3.0 weighted (Medallion) / 3.5 weighted (Academic Scholar) Test: SAT/ACT + community-service hours (varies by tier) Income: No income limit

Florida's merit scholarship pays 75–100% of in-state tuition by tier. Use our Bright Futures calculator for the exact GPA, test, and service-hour cutoffs. (Use our Bright Futures calculator for exact GPA, test & service thresholds.)

📊 Florida School Grade

Florida's official A–F school grade.

Every Florida public school earns an annual A–F grade from the state — the single signal Florida families (and the housing market) watch most. It rolls achievement, learning gains, graduation, and college/career readiness into one letter.

FLDOE Grade
A
2023-24
Points Earned
71%
of total possible (A ≥ 62%)
How does Florida grade a high school? →

A high school's grade is the percent of possible points across up to 11 components — English/math achievement and learning gains, science & social-studies achievement, the 4-year graduation rate, and College & Career Acceleration: the share of graduates who earned college credit (via AP, IB, AICE, or dual enrollment) or an industry certification. Letter cutoffs: A ≥ 62%, B ≥ 54%, C ≥ 41%, D ≥ 32%, F below.

Source: Florida Department of Education, School Grades, 2023-24. Graduation rate & College/Career Acceleration components reflect the prior cohort year, per FLDOE's grading model.
